Skip to content

Commit 9e9e68e

Browse files
authored
Merge pull request #37 from Coeur/BuildSystemType=original
Changing build system to original to allow working build rules.
2 parents 9b41fb7 + 74cf358 commit 9e9e68e

File tree

6 files changed

+202
-0
lines changed

6 files changed

+202
-0
lines changed

cd to ....xcodeproj/project.pbxproj

Lines changed: 46 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-580,7 +580,30 @@
580580
C01FCF4F08A954540054247B /* Debug */ = {
581581
isa = XCBuildConfiguration;
582582
buildSettings = {
583+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
584+
CLANG_WARN_BOOL_CONVERSION = YES;
585+
CLANG_WARN_COMMA = YES;
586+
CLANG_WARN_CONSTANT_CONVERSION = YES;
587+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
588+
CLANG_WARN_EMPTY_BODY = YES;
589+
CLANG_WARN_ENUM_CONVERSION = YES;
590+
CLANG_WARN_INFINITE_RECURSION = YES;
591+
CLANG_WARN_INT_CONVERSION = YES;
592+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
593+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
594+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
595+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
596+
CLANG_WARN_STRICT_PROTOTYPES = YES;
597+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
598+
CLANG_WARN_UNREACHABLE_CODE = YES;
599+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
600+
ENABLE_STRICT_OBJC_MSGSEND = YES;
601+
GCC_NO_COMMON_BLOCKS = YES;
602+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
583603
GCC_WARN_ABOUT_RETURN_TYPE = YES;
604+
GCC_WARN_UNDECLARED_SELECTOR = YES;
605+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
606+
GCC_WARN_UNUSED_FUNCTION = YES;
584607
GCC_WARN_UNUSED_VARIABLE = YES;
585608
INSTALL_PATH = "";
586609
MACOSX_DEPLOYMENT_TARGET = 10.8;
@@ -592,7 +615,30 @@
592615
C01FCF5008A954540054247B /* Release */ = {
593616
isa = XCBuildConfiguration;
594617
buildSettings = {
618+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
619+
CLANG_WARN_BOOL_CONVERSION = YES;
620+
CLANG_WARN_COMMA = YES;
621+
CLANG_WARN_CONSTANT_CONVERSION = YES;
622+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
623+
CLANG_WARN_EMPTY_BODY = YES;
624+
CLANG_WARN_ENUM_CONVERSION = YES;
625+
CLANG_WARN_INFINITE_RECURSION = YES;
626+
CLANG_WARN_INT_CONVERSION = YES;
627+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
628+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
629+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
630+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
631+
CLANG_WARN_STRICT_PROTOTYPES = YES;
632+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
633+
CLANG_WARN_UNREACHABLE_CODE = YES;
634+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
635+
ENABLE_STRICT_OBJC_MSGSEND = YES;
636+
GCC_NO_COMMON_BLOCKS = YES;
637+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
595638
GCC_WARN_ABOUT_RETURN_TYPE = YES;
639+
GCC_WARN_UNDECLARED_SELECTOR = YES;
640+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
641+
GCC_WARN_UNUSED_FUNCTION = YES;
596642
GCC_WARN_UNUSED_VARIABLE = YES;
597643
INSTALL_PATH = "";
598644
MACOSX_DEPLOYMENT_TARGET = 10.8;
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,8 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
3+
<plist version="1.0">
4+
<dict>
5+
<key>IDEDidComputeMac32BitWarning</key>
6+
<true/>
7+
</dict>
8+
</plist>
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,10 @@
1+
<?xml version="1.0" encoding="UTF-8"?>
2+
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
3+
<plist version="1.0">
4+
<dict>
5+
<key>BuildSystemType</key>
6+
<string>Original</string>
7+
<key>PreviewsEnabled</key>
8+
<false/>
9+
</dict>
10+
</plist>

plugins/X11_xterm/X11_xterm.xcodeproj/project.pbxproj

Lines changed: 46 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-235,8 +235,31 @@
235235
1DEB913F08733D840010E9CD /* Debug */ = {
236236
isa = XCBuildConfiguration;
237237
buildSettings = {
238+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
239+
CLANG_WARN_BOOL_CONVERSION = YES;
240+
CLANG_WARN_COMMA = YES;
241+
CLANG_WARN_CONSTANT_CONVERSION = YES;
242+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
243+
CLANG_WARN_EMPTY_BODY = YES;
244+
CLANG_WARN_ENUM_CONVERSION = YES;
245+
CLANG_WARN_INFINITE_RECURSION = YES;
246+
CLANG_WARN_INT_CONVERSION = YES;
247+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
248+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
249+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
250+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
251+
CLANG_WARN_STRICT_PROTOTYPES = YES;
252+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
253+
CLANG_WARN_UNREACHABLE_CODE = YES;
254+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
238255
CODE_SIGN_IDENTITY = "Developer ID Application";
256+
ENABLE_STRICT_OBJC_MSGSEND = YES;
257+
GCC_NO_COMMON_BLOCKS = YES;
258+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
239259
GCC_WARN_ABOUT_RETURN_TYPE = YES;
260+
GCC_WARN_UNDECLARED_SELECTOR = YES;
261+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
262+
GCC_WARN_UNUSED_FUNCTION = YES;
240263
GCC_WARN_UNUSED_VARIABLE = YES;
241264
ONLY_ACTIVE_ARCH = YES;
242265
SDKROOT = macosx;
@@ -246,8 +269,31 @@
246269
1DEB914008733D840010E9CD /* Release */ = {
247270
isa = XCBuildConfiguration;
248271
buildSettings = {
272+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
273+
CLANG_WARN_BOOL_CONVERSION = YES;
274+
CLANG_WARN_COMMA = YES;
275+
CLANG_WARN_CONSTANT_CONVERSION = YES;
276+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
277+
CLANG_WARN_EMPTY_BODY = YES;
278+
CLANG_WARN_ENUM_CONVERSION = YES;
279+
CLANG_WARN_INFINITE_RECURSION = YES;
280+
CLANG_WARN_INT_CONVERSION = YES;
281+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
282+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
283+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
284+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
285+
CLANG_WARN_STRICT_PROTOTYPES = YES;
286+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
287+
CLANG_WARN_UNREACHABLE_CODE = YES;
288+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
249289
CODE_SIGN_IDENTITY = "Developer ID Application";
290+
ENABLE_STRICT_OBJC_MSGSEND = YES;
291+
GCC_NO_COMMON_BLOCKS = YES;
292+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
250293
GCC_WARN_ABOUT_RETURN_TYPE = YES;
294+
GCC_WARN_UNDECLARED_SELECTOR = YES;
295+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
296+
GCC_WARN_UNUSED_FUNCTION = YES;
251297
GCC_WARN_UNUSED_VARIABLE = YES;
252298
SDKROOT = macosx;
253299
};

plugins/iterm/iterm.xcodeproj/project.pbxproj

Lines changed: 46 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-235,8 +235,31 @@
235235
1DEB913F08733D840010E9CD /* Debug */ = {
236236
isa = XCBuildConfiguration;
237237
buildSettings = {
238+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
239+
CLANG_WARN_BOOL_CONVERSION = YES;
240+
CLANG_WARN_COMMA = YES;
241+
CLANG_WARN_CONSTANT_CONVERSION = YES;
242+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
243+
CLANG_WARN_EMPTY_BODY = YES;
244+
CLANG_WARN_ENUM_CONVERSION = YES;
245+
CLANG_WARN_INFINITE_RECURSION = YES;
246+
CLANG_WARN_INT_CONVERSION = YES;
247+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
248+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
249+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
250+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
251+
CLANG_WARN_STRICT_PROTOTYPES = YES;
252+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
253+
CLANG_WARN_UNREACHABLE_CODE = YES;
254+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
238255
CODE_SIGN_IDENTITY = "Developer ID Application";
256+
ENABLE_STRICT_OBJC_MSGSEND = YES;
257+
GCC_NO_COMMON_BLOCKS = YES;
258+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
239259
GCC_WARN_ABOUT_RETURN_TYPE = YES;
260+
GCC_WARN_UNDECLARED_SELECTOR = YES;
261+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
262+
GCC_WARN_UNUSED_FUNCTION = YES;
240263
GCC_WARN_UNUSED_VARIABLE = YES;
241264
ONLY_ACTIVE_ARCH = YES;
242265
SDKROOT = macosx;
@@ -246,8 +269,31 @@
246269
1DEB914008733D840010E9CD /* Release */ = {
247270
isa = XCBuildConfiguration;
248271
buildSettings = {
272+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
273+
CLANG_WARN_BOOL_CONVERSION = YES;
274+
CLANG_WARN_COMMA = YES;
275+
CLANG_WARN_CONSTANT_CONVERSION = YES;
276+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
277+
CLANG_WARN_EMPTY_BODY = YES;
278+
CLANG_WARN_ENUM_CONVERSION = YES;
279+
CLANG_WARN_INFINITE_RECURSION = YES;
280+
CLANG_WARN_INT_CONVERSION = YES;
281+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
282+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
283+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
284+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
285+
CLANG_WARN_STRICT_PROTOTYPES = YES;
286+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
287+
CLANG_WARN_UNREACHABLE_CODE = YES;
288+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
249289
CODE_SIGN_IDENTITY = "Developer ID Application";
290+
ENABLE_STRICT_OBJC_MSGSEND = YES;
291+
GCC_NO_COMMON_BLOCKS = YES;
292+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
250293
GCC_WARN_ABOUT_RETURN_TYPE = YES;
294+
GCC_WARN_UNDECLARED_SELECTOR = YES;
295+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
296+
GCC_WARN_UNUSED_FUNCTION = YES;
251297
GCC_WARN_UNUSED_VARIABLE = YES;
252298
SDKROOT = macosx;
253299
};

plugins/terminal/terminal.xcodeproj/project.pbxproj

Lines changed: 46 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-224,8 +224,31 @@
224224
1DEB913F08733D840010E9CD /* Debug */ = {
225225
isa = XCBuildConfiguration;
226226
buildSettings = {
227+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
228+
CLANG_WARN_BOOL_CONVERSION = YES;
229+
CLANG_WARN_COMMA = YES;
230+
CLANG_WARN_CONSTANT_CONVERSION = YES;
231+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
232+
CLANG_WARN_EMPTY_BODY = YES;
233+
CLANG_WARN_ENUM_CONVERSION = YES;
234+
CLANG_WARN_INFINITE_RECURSION = YES;
235+
CLANG_WARN_INT_CONVERSION = YES;
236+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
237+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
238+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
239+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
240+
CLANG_WARN_STRICT_PROTOTYPES = YES;
241+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
242+
CLANG_WARN_UNREACHABLE_CODE = YES;
243+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
227244
CODE_SIGN_IDENTITY = "Developer ID Application";
245+
ENABLE_STRICT_OBJC_MSGSEND = YES;
246+
GCC_NO_COMMON_BLOCKS = YES;
247+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
228248
GCC_WARN_ABOUT_RETURN_TYPE = YES;
249+
GCC_WARN_UNDECLARED_SELECTOR = YES;
250+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
251+
GCC_WARN_UNUSED_FUNCTION = YES;
229252
GCC_WARN_UNUSED_VARIABLE = YES;
230253
INSTALL_PATH = /unsigned/plugins;
231254
ONLY_ACTIVE_ARCH = YES;
@@ -236,8 +259,31 @@
236259
1DEB914008733D840010E9CD /* Release */ = {
237260
isa = XCBuildConfiguration;
238261
buildSettings = {
262+
CLANG_WARN_BLOCK_CAPTURE_AUTORELEASING = YES;
263+
CLANG_WARN_BOOL_CONVERSION = YES;
264+
CLANG_WARN_COMMA = YES;
265+
CLANG_WARN_CONSTANT_CONVERSION = YES;
266+
CLANG_WARN_DEPRECATED_OBJC_IMPLEMENTATIONS = YES;
267+
CLANG_WARN_EMPTY_BODY = YES;
268+
CLANG_WARN_ENUM_CONVERSION = YES;
269+
CLANG_WARN_INFINITE_RECURSION = YES;
270+
CLANG_WARN_INT_CONVERSION = YES;
271+
CLANG_WARN_NON_LITERAL_NULL_CONVERSION = YES;
272+
CLANG_WARN_OBJC_IMPLICIT_RETAIN_SELF = YES;
273+
CLANG_WARN_OBJC_LITERAL_CONVERSION = YES;
274+
CLANG_WARN_RANGE_LOOP_ANALYSIS = YES;
275+
CLANG_WARN_STRICT_PROTOTYPES = YES;
276+
CLANG_WARN_SUSPICIOUS_MOVE = YES;
277+
CLANG_WARN_UNREACHABLE_CODE = YES;
278+
CLANG_WARN__DUPLICATE_METHOD_MATCH = YES;
239279
CODE_SIGN_IDENTITY = "Developer ID Application";
280+
ENABLE_STRICT_OBJC_MSGSEND = YES;
281+
GCC_NO_COMMON_BLOCKS = YES;
282+
GCC_WARN_64_TO_32_BIT_CONVERSION = YES;
240283
GCC_WARN_ABOUT_RETURN_TYPE = YES;
284+
GCC_WARN_UNDECLARED_SELECTOR = YES;
285+
GCC_WARN_UNINITIALIZED_AUTOS = YES;
286+
GCC_WARN_UNUSED_FUNCTION = YES;
241287
GCC_WARN_UNUSED_VARIABLE = YES;
242288
INSTALL_PATH = /unsigned/plugins;
243289
SDKROOT = macosx;

0 commit comments

Comments
 (0)